TL;DR: A damp proof membrane (DPM) is a heavy-duty polythene sheet laid beneath concrete slabs or against walls to stop ground moisture rising into a building. Choosing the right gauge—1000g, 1200g, or 2000g—depends on the ground conditions and the level of protection required. Get it wrong, and your floor will know about it.

What Does a Damp Proof Membrane Actually Do?

At its core, a DPM creates a continuous physical barrier between the ground and whatever sits on top of it — usually a concrete slab. Groundwater contains moisture vapour, and without a membrane in place, that moisture travels upward through the concrete by capillary action. Left unchecked, it causes floor coverings to lift, adhesives to fail, screeds to delaminate, and structural materials to degrade over time.

Beyond moisture control, a well-installed polythene sheeting layer also helps protect against radon gas ingress in certain high-risk areas — something Building Regulations (Part C) take very seriously. What Gauge DPM Do You Need?

Gauge — measured in microns (µm) or grams per square metre (g/m²) — tells you how thick the membrane is. Thicker means more durable, more puncture-resistant, and better suited to demanding ground conditions. Here's a practical breakdown:

Is 1000g DPM Enough for Your Project?

A 1000g damp proof membrane (roughly 250 microns) is the entry-level option and is commonly used for light-duty applications where ground conditions are relatively clean and well-prepared. It meets the minimum requirements for many standard domestic builds, though it offers less resistance to tears and punctures during installation.

Think of it as the economy option — perfectly adequate when conditions are ideal, but a little less forgiving if your sub-base is less than pristine.

When Should You Use a 1200g Damp Proof Membrane?

The 1200g damp proof membrane is the middle ground, and for most standard construction projects, it's the sweet spot. 1200g polythene sheeting offers improved puncture resistance during installation, better durability when laid over uneven or rougher substrates, and solid compliance with BS 8102 for below-ground waterproofing guidance.

If you're unsure which gauge to specify and the ground conditions are average, the 1200g DPM is the sensible default. It handles most residential and commercial groundwork applications without issue. 1200g polythene is stocked widely for exactly this reason.

What Are the Benefits of a 2000g DPM for Heavy-Duty Applications?

This is where things get serious. A 2000g damp proof membrane (500 microns) is designed for demanding ground conditions — think aggressive backfill, sharp aggregate, high hydrostatic pressure, or commercial and industrial projects where failure simply isn't an option.

2000g polythene sheeting is significantly more resistant to tearing, puncturing, and stress during compaction. It also offers superior long-term performance in wet or chemically aggressive ground. If you're building on difficult land or specifying for a commercial client who wants belt-and-braces protection, the 2000g DPM is the right call.

2000g polythene is also commonly used as a temporary cover sheeting on sites where heavy foot traffic or plant movement is expected — it takes a beating and keeps doing its job.

Does Colour Matter When Choosing Polythene Sheeting?

Short answer: not for performance. Long answer: sometimes, yes — depending on your application.

Black polythene is the most widely used option for DPM applications. The carbon black additive that gives it its colour also provides UV stabilisation and adds to its durability. For below-ground use, it's the industry standard.

Clear or natural polythene tends to be used more for temporary protection, wrapping, or applications where visibility matters. For a damp proof membrane, stick with black — it's the tried and tested choice and one that survives any scrutiny from a building inspector who's having a difficult morning.

What About Fire Retardant Polythene?

For projects where fire safety is a consideration — think occupied sites, refurbishments, or works near ignition sources — standard polythene may not be suitable. Fire retardant polythene and flame retardant polythene sheeting is manufactured with additives that slow the spread of flame, meeting the requirements of certain site safety regulations.

It's worth noting that fire retardant grades are available across multiple gauges and configurations, so you don't have to sacrifice performance for safety compliance. If your project specifies FR materials, make sure your sheeting matches the spec — don't assume all polythene rolls behave the same under heat.

How to Install a Damp Proof Membrane Correctly

Getting the right material is half the battle. Installation matters just as much. A membrane full of holes or poorly lapped joints is barely more effective than no membrane at all.

Key installation steps:

  • Prepare the sub-base — Remove sharp stones, debris, or anything that could puncture the membrane before it's laid. A sand blinding layer is often used to create a smooth, protective surface.
  • Lay the membrane flat — Avoid stretching or bunching the sheeting. Smooth it out across the entire floor area.
  • Lap the joints correctly — Overlaps should be a minimum of 300mm, sealed with appropriate jointing tape to maintain continuity.
  • Turn up the edges — The membrane should extend up the internal wall face to tie into the wall's DPC (damp proof course), creating a complete moisture barrier.
  • Protect during concrete pour — Once laid, avoid unnecessary foot traffic over the membrane before the slab is poured. Even a small puncture can compromise performance.

How Many Polythene Rolls Do You Need?

This one's simple maths — but it's worth double-checking before you order. Calculate the total floor area, add extra for overlaps (a minimum of 300mm per joint), and factor in the edge turn-ups. Running out mid-pour is not a position anyone wants to be in.

Polythene rolls are available in a range of widths and lengths to suit different project scales. Ordering slightly more than you think you need is always the smarter call — offcuts have a habit of coming in useful.

Frequently Asked Questions About Damp Proof Membranes

What is the minimum thickness for a damp proof membrane under a concrete slab?
Building Regulations in the UK (Approved Document C) require a minimum thickness of 300 microns (approximately 1200g) for a DPM beneath a concrete floor slab. Some specifications call for heavier grades, particularly in areas with high ground moisture or aggressive subsoil conditions.

Can I use a damp proof membrane on an existing concrete floor?
Yes. In retrofit situations, a DPM can be laid on top of an existing slab and overlaid with a new screed. In this case, the membrane acts as a vapour control layer rather than a ground barrier. A 1200g or 2000g grade is typically recommended to handle the screed load without puncturing.

How long does a polythene damp proof membrane last?
When properly installed and undamaged, a quality polythene DPM has a service life of 50+ years. The material is chemically inert, resistant to ground moisture, and does not degrade in normal below-ground conditions.

What's the difference between a DPM and a vapour barrier?
A DPM is installed below a concrete slab to prevent ground moisture rising into the structure. A vapour control layer (VCL) is used within the building fabric — typically in walls or roofs — to manage condensation risk. They perform similar functions but in different locations and at different stages of the build.

Is fire retardant polythene required on all construction sites?
Not universally, but it may be specified by a principal contractor's site safety policy, particularly on occupied or sensitive sites. Always check the project specification and site rules before ordering.

Can polythene sheeting be used for purposes other than DPM?
Absolutely. Polythene sheeting is one of the most versatile materials on a construction site — used for temporary weatherproofing, concrete curing, surface protection, dust control, waste containment, and more. Having the right grade for the right job is the key.
